When the SOB first introduced the Treno Gottardo last year I rode it down to Locarno and back quite a few times just to fight the boredom of home office (also the proud owner of a GA). In those first few months the trains were practically empty on weekdays, and the conductors were even giving out coffee tokens and small packaged cookies for free.

The family compartment at the front/end has nice, large tables – perfect for setting up a small "office on wheels". Mobile reception is also generally okay along the way (sadly the same cannot be said of e.g. the Albula and Bernina lines).

They show up regularly on the IC 8 from Brig to Visp – Bern – Zürich – Romanshorn on busy weekend afternoons in the high season, usually at the front of the train (sector A in Visp). Especially in good weather those trains can get extremely crowded from Visp onwards so smart positioning on the platform is key.

You can tell whether a double-decker train will have extra cars (which are frequently 1st class ones) by looking at the train composition in the SBB app: normally the "FA" family car is either at the front or at the end of the train, so if it's in shown in the middle then that's a good sign.
